Received: by 10.223.185.116 with SMTP id b49csp3092146wrg; Mon, 5 Mar 2018 14:03:14 -0800 (PST) X-Google-Smtp-Source: AG47ELsu7ajSaSmy8B5TEnI39OBdUcYTxv69CisgK5pgDwcfaaz8vkQwRo8gWCrkL6MMnCxAmIiK X-Received: by 10.98.214.10 with SMTP id r10mr16743497pfg.8.1520287394209; Mon, 05 Mar 2018 14:03:14 -0800 (PST) ARC-Seal: i=1; a=rsa-sha256; t=1520287394; cv=none; d=google.com; s=arc-20160816; b=o8iRJsBUbxMbVvlui8r84lhjihzCwrLk/tHs9zoF/n3N1yvkZgYdbK20SRcd6KSd+Q vDE6nR6NcSqwVrO7V37TUQJ++mespoTYyTckxiGFvTkTm5XcTSMWZK06xhk2B/xxHeKb jwrDeIl2kE8uap8LMR4cV4AYbZ63pF1vCDLldUT49zCHwVXVFG4nnSYVsUTyNARyMeyI gdXS6i20SriYckZY6QoIvYE6kKU7/RxRJlnu2AutDDRy7bCSkKii9xf2RdRcs3RTnvUs g42Gfa4Bkl4CjNcCCxnjs5yEvKgeB3gFnqh4Pzq/G/RP7dAudafk6GPcQt/LbWoXuOGJ /Zlg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:user-agent:in-reply-to :content-disposition:mime-version:references:message-id:subject:cc :to:from:date:arc-authentication-results; bh=NG/wGNckYOeqrzAxNAbvPkosd4PSbXaZN+wh0bVfRrM=; b=BEO3omXEsavXty6JOdATj4gRwAPGMzK1Cz5m3bix0o06aajN9GnQAK6dM0cxuVgh2d /+o1TkVyFjetvT7O4e6MRalANDdeRVOvcl8icCtDTrP8AATVEjimygyXO329hJYeLH1y 20kryoFVNSM7y5oBxF5iAcGiyS6MCli+RR7lEzFQ2RnnO90OfJZPdtJgxOGEldL+QycH dNTb0IgHDQGGjAkzFBQ4mZJyrNbISww+h7p9YNxkkgrPBbabIbQsw6v7yClBp2FT5ImX JEdEulOjJuWu9V6k5duON2dTCeognaSPfNIovwFfyGrtwsBbkA9c7bN8/gZqQ2Ln4/Na jIdg==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id 74si8890966pgc.719.2018.03.05.14.02.59; Mon, 05 Mar 2018 14:03:14 -0800 (PST)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1753184AbeCEWCE (ORCPT + 99 others); Mon, 5 Mar 2018 17:02:04 -0500 Received: from mail-oi0-f67.google.com ([209.85.218.67]:34822 "EHLO mail-oi0-f67.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753035AbeCEWCC (ORCPT ); Mon, 5 Mar 2018 17:02:02 -0500 Received: by mail-oi0-f67.google.com with SMTP id x10so13302487oig.2; Mon, 05 Mar 2018 14:02:02 -0800 (PST)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:date:from:to:cc:subject:message-id:references :mime-version:content-disposition:in-reply-to:user-agent; bh=NG/wGNckYOeqrzAxNAbvPkosd4PSbXaZN+wh0bVfRrM=; b=Mn+y0pHkIptuwjc2jA7jCG03hsRVRtDMHT3uzth2C5oeDLus6ZxYq2NkCinFB3s5d6 5BEBy7kHlww2ZnKVXPOAiefihLUkz+BOqGLeNifFqHKKh7BKkPTEc3Dxh1hndDbXFZ+i iKJdroc2PlzhIdH6BBtuuJ28JV74vD+PSusBy8Ci/j1oy9iHeziEYLei/AOLL7qhvSa3 PfaVWyAjWApLnrKeMe0058/fJXPt4TW5cM1UureRsCatBBazsoey5yNxWNBDEcdOLslT ssktAlsOvDgPyxJQiBFShGM4eUz32GrscK5QYwV1QVNkQVEYmHelqPgjayp+f/uzeG/R cOyw== X-Gm-Message-State: AElRT7H1cLXxe/xytxeN505nHsQtTEr1aV+mVY5tr3uM1Zm7nnkaylIg qBZNQwq8rIchP0/+4E34rQ== X-Received: by 10.202.186.6 with SMTP id k6mr10863159oif.169.1520287321933; Mon, 05 Mar 2018 14:02:01 -0800 (PST) Received: from localhost (216-188-254-6.dyn.grandenetworks.net. [216.188.254.6]) by smtp.gmail.com with ESMTPSA id y184sm6469111oig.26.2018.03.05.14.02.01 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Mon, 05 Mar 2018 14:02:01 -0800 (PST) Date: Mon, 5 Mar 2018 16:02:00 -0600 From: Rob Herring To: Can Guo Cc: subhashj@codeaurora.org, asutoshd@codeaurora.org, vivek.gautam@codeaurora.org, rnayak@codeaurora.org, vinholikatti@gmail.com, jejb@linux.vnet.ibm.com, martin.petersen@oracle.com, linux-scsi@vger.kernel.org, Gilad Broner , Mark Rutland , Venkat Gopalakrishnan , Yaniv Gardi , Sujit Reddy Thumma , Amit Nischal , Maya Erez , "open list:OPEN FIRMWARE AND FLATTENED DEVICE TREE BINDINGS" , open list Subject: Re: [PATCH v2] scsi: ufs-qcom: add number of lanes for Tx and Rx links Message-ID: <20180305220200.rah223rn4ndq7hd4@rob-hp-laptop> References: <20180227055500.10416-1-cang@codeaurora.org>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20180227055500.10416-1-cang@codeaurora.org> User-Agent: NeoMutt/20170609 (1.8.3)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Feb 27, 2018 at 01:46:17PM +0800, Can Guo wrote: > From: Gilad Broner > > Different platforms may have different number of lanes for the UFS Tx/Rx > links. Add parameter to device tree specifying how many lanes should be > configured for the UFS Tx/Rx links. And don't print err message for clocks > that are optional, this leads to unnecessary confusion about failure. > > Signed-off-by: Gilad Broner > Signed-off-by: Subhash Jadavani > Signed-off-by: Can Guo > --- > > Changes since v1: > - Change commit subject for better description. > - Incorporated Rob's review comments to use lanes-tx and lanes-rx > to handle asymmetric Tx/Rx links. > > .../devicetree/bindings/ufs/ufshcd-pltfrm.txt | 4 ++ Reviewed-by: Rob Herring > drivers/scsi/ufs/ufs-qcom.c | 65 +++++++++++++--------- > drivers/scsi/ufs/ufshcd.c | 29 ++++++++++ > drivers/scsi/ufs/ufshcd.h | 5 ++ > 4 files changed, 78 insertions(+), 25 deletions(-)